Thirteen decreased by a number​

Mathematics
2 answers:
Katena32 [7]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

13 -n

Step-by-step explanation:

Decreased means subtract

Let n equal the number

13 -n

Thrice the difference between X and 4 is less than 9
NeX [460]
Thrice means three, so 3 times the difference of x and 4.

3(x - 4) < 9
multiply 3 by all in parentheses
(3*x) + (3*-4) < 9
3x - 12 < 9
add 12 to both sides
3x < 21
divide both sides by 3
x < 7

ANSWER: x < 7
